<br />~ <br /> <br />CHILD SUPPORT AWARENESS MONTH <br />IN CABARRUS COUNTY <br /> <br />A PROCLAMATION <br /> <br />WHEREAS, the welfare of our children is the most important responsibility <br />we have as parents. A child should be able to depend on support from both <br />parents; and <br /> <br />WHEREAS, children who do not receive adequate financial and emotional <br />support from both parents may experience greater difficulty in becoming <br />healthy, happy, and productive citizens of this County. In such cases, the <br />taxpayers of this County support the children whose parents fail to meet <br />this responsibility; and <br /> <br />WHEREAS, many concerned and dedicated judges, district attorneys, <br />clerks of court, sheriffs' personnel, and child support professionals work to <br />provide this service to Cabarrus County's children. . . our future; <br /> <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that the Cabarrus County Board <br />of Commissioners does hereby proclaim the month of August as <br /> <br />CHILD SUPPORT AWARENESS MONTH IN CABARRUS COUNTY <br /> <br />and urges all parents who are currently under court order to regularly pay <br />their child support. <br /> <br />This the <br /> <br />day of July, 2005 <br /> <br />Carolyn Carpenter <br />Chairman, Cabarrus County <br />Board of Commissioners <br /> <br />C-I <br />
